Right shifting binary
WebEffectively, a right shift rounds towards negative infinity. Edit: According to the Section 6.5.7 of the latest draft standard, this behavior on negative numbers is implementation dependent: The result of E1 >> E2 is E1 right-shifted E2 bit positions. If E1 has an unsigned type or if E1 has a signed type and a nonnegative value, the value of ... WebApr 5, 2024 · The right shift ( >>) operator returns a number or BigInt whose binary representation is the first operand shifted by the specified number of bits to the right. …
Right shifting binary
Did you know?
WebFeb 7, 2024 · The bitwise and shift operators include unary bitwise complement, binary left and right shift, unsigned right shift, and the binary logical AND, OR, and exclusive OR … WebDivision. To divide a number, a binary shift moves all the digits in the binary number along to the right and fills the gaps after the shift with 0: Result: shifting one place to the right gives ...
WebTo divide a number, a binary shift moves all the digits in the binary number along to the right: to divide by two, all digits shift one place to the right to divide by four, all digits shift … WebApr 5, 2024 · The unsigned right shift ( >>>) operator returns a number whose binary representation is the first operand shifted by the specified number of bits to the right. …
WebMar 1,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. WebBinary shifting is when you move a binary number to the left or right. When shifting to the left, we add a new 0 onto the right-hand side of our binary sequence. When shifting to the …
WebSep 29, 2024 · The bitwise right shift operator in python shifts the bits of the binary representation of the input number to the right side by a specified number of places. The …
WebRight Shift Operator; Left Shift Operator. The left shift operator is a type of Bitwise shift operator, which performs operations on the binary bits. It is a binary operator that requires two operands to shift or move the position of the bits to the left side and add zeroes to the empty space created at the right side after shifting the bits ... federal way district courtWebDec 27, 2024 · Returns binary shift right operation on a pair of numbers: value >> (shift%64). If n is negative, a NULL value is returned. deep creek lake maryland 10 day weatherWebC++ supports the following bitwise operators: & for bitwise and, for bitwise or, ^ for bitwise xor, ~ for bitwise not, << for bitwise left shift, and >> for bitwise right shift. Ternary Operator: The ternary operator in C++ is a shorthand way to write an if-else statement in a single line. deep creek lake front property for saleWebIn computer programming, an arithmetic shift is a shift operator, sometimes termed a signed shift (though it is not restricted to signed operands). The two basic types are the arithmetic left shift and the arithmetic right shift.For binary numbers it is a bitwise operation that shifts all of the bits of its operand; every bit in the operand is simply moved a given … federal way district court recordsWeb1. What Binary Shifting Is. Binary shifting is where we take any binary number and then shift it to the left or the right. We then replace the empty space with a 0. We can see this in action by demonstrating a binary shift to the left. Worked Example 1 – Shifting to the Left. Let’s take the binary number 110 and shift it to the left by 2 ... federal way dmv hoursWeb#binarynumbers #digitalelectronics #digitalsystems #physics #numbersystem #binarynumbers Logical Operations of Binary Numbers With Solved Examples.🌟 ABOUT T... deep creek lake front rentals with dockWebApr 13, 2024 · Right Shift (>>) It is a binary operator that takes two numbers, right shifts the bits of the first operand, and the second operand decides the number of places to shift. … deep creek lake golf courses